-
[ASP.NET C# 2.0] Eval
Bonjour,
Question compilation :
Pourquoi au sein d'une page aspx j'ai ce bout de code qui se compile:
Code:
<asp:CheckBox ID="cbTri_<%#Eval("Id")%>" runat="server" />
et celui-ci qui passe pas:
Code:
<asp:CheckBox ID="cbTri_<%#DataBinder.Eval(Container.DataItem, "Id")%>" runat="server" />
Quelles sont les subtilités différenciant ces 2 méthodes permettant de parcourir notre liste ?
Vous me direz que dès il y en a une qui marche c'est cool... Mais dans le fond voilà ce que je cherche à faire :
Code:
<asp:CheckBox ID="cbTri_<%#DataBinder.Eval(Container, "ItemIndex")%>" runat="server" />
...et là je ne sais pas ou plutôt j'y arrive pas !!
Merci d'avance,
Mow
-
Ta checkbox est databindée à qqchose?
-
Oui, en fait elle se retrouve à l'intérieur d'un controle Repeater qui lui est lié à une source de données.
(J'espère avoir répondu à ta question)
Mow